One primary factor influencing your purchase decision is the type of material used in the sanding discs. Discs made from aluminum oxide are common due to their durability and versatility across different surfaces. In contrast, zirconia sanding discs tend to last longer when used on metal, making them particularly favored in industrial applications. The performance of sanding discs is heavily influenced by the grit size. Coarser grit (e.g., 40-60) is ideal for heavy material removal, while finer grit (e.g., 120-220) allows for finishing touch-ups. According to a study conducted by the Abrasive Manufacturer's Association, 75% of professionals reported that selecting the right grit size improved their workflow efficiency significantly. Therefore, understanding your specific project requirements is critical.
Another factor to consider is the shape of the sanding disc. Circular discs are standard for most power sanders, while triangular or other shapes may be better suited for specific applications, such as sanding corners or tight spaces. Material compatibility is vital. For instance, using a sanding disc made for wood on metal surfaces could result in inadequate performance and damage to both the material and the disc. It's important to match the sanding disc type with your project's material to maximize effectiveness.
